Garden Vegetable Pizza with Mozzarella

Instructions
Preheat the oven to 450°F (230°C). Position a rack in the lower-middle of the oven to promote an evenly crisp crust.
In a small bowl, stir the tomato sauce with a drizzle of olive oil, oregano, black pepper, and salt if needed. Taste and adjust seasoning; skip added salt if the sauce is already well-seasoned.
Prepare the vegetables: thinly slice the onion, mushrooms, and red pepper; halve the cherry tomatoes; roughly chop the spinach. Pat vegetables dry to prevent excess moisture.
On a lightly floured surface, roll the pizza dough to your desired thickness. Transfer it to a baking tray or preheated pizza stone.
Spread the seasoned tomato sauce evenly over the dough, leaving a small border around the edges for the crust.
Sprinkle the mozzarella evenly over the sauce.
Distribute the vegetables—onion, mushrooms, red pepper, cherry tomatoes, and spinach—across the pizza for even coverage.
Bake for 20–25 minutes, until the cheese is fully melted, the vegetables are tender, and the crust is golden brown.
Remove from the oven, garnish with fresh basil, slice, and serve hot.
